Postgraduate IT tutors will be available in the following halls between 5:30-8:30pm during the Welcome Programme: Tuesday Cripps, Hugh Stewart, Derby and Lincoln Wednesday Cripps, Hugh Stewart, Derby, Lincoln and Lenton & Wortley Thursday All Welcome Programme halls Friday All Welcome Programme halls University registration All students must register with the University at the beginning of each new academic session. New students must complete two stages to finalise their registration - online registration through the portal portal.nottingham.ac.uk and in-person registration. Students attending the Welcome Programme should complete in-person registration on Friday 20 September. Please note that you will need your passport and visa when you register in person. Further information can be found online at currentstudents/registration Students who need to show their original academic documents/certificates to a member of staff in the Admissions Office should bring these along to the registration event. Please note that you do not need to attend University registration during Week One if you complete your university registration as part of the Welcome Programme. University cards It will be possible to collect your card during the Welcome Programme if you have uploaded your photograph before 6 September If you have not uploaded your photograph it will be possible to have a photograph taken at the Security Office behind the Hallward Library on the University Park Campus on Sunday 22 September between 10am and 4pm. Banking information There will be two banks taking part in the Welcome Programme Natwest and Santander. Staff from the banks will be available on Tuesday, Thursday and Friday between 10am and 4pm. In order to open a bank account in the UK you will need a special letter from the University. To obtain this letter, please complete the request form in the Welcome Pack and take the form with your passport to the room indicated: Natwest, West Concourse Lounge Santander, C20 If you wish to open an account with a bank not listed please hand in your request form at the West Concourse Lounge. If you are opening an account with one of the banks on campus, the official University letter will be sent directly to the bank on your behalf. If you are opening an account with one of the banks offcampus including Lloyds TSB and HSBC you should collect the official University letter from the Student Services Centre and take it to the bank.
